Arnold Maki was born October 26, 1914, at Wakefield, Michigan, to Victor and Louise Latthe Maki. He married Laila Lonnberg on October 25, 1952 at Waukegan, IL. He was a painter most of his career for the civil service. Mr. Maki was an Army veteran of WWII. He lived in Lake Villa, IL before moving to Mountain Home in July of 1977. He was an avid golfer, Chicago Cub and Bears fan, and former member of Twin Lakes Golf Course. He was of the Lutheran faith.
